What materials are best for sound insulation in a home?
Mineral wool, fiberglass, and cellulose are effective for sound insulation as they absorb sound waves. Mass-loaded vinyl (MLV) and acoustic panels can also enhance soundproofing. Dense materials like gypsum board and concrete provide effective barriers to sound transmission. Carpet and curtains can help reduce noise levels within a room.
How can I improve sound insulation in an existing building?
Improve sound insulation in an existing building by adding mass to walls with materials like dense drywall, using resilient channels or soundproofing clips, sealing gaps with acoustic caulk, installing high-density insulation, using soundproof doors and windows, and adding carpets or heavy curtains to absorb sound.
What are the benefits of sound insulation in residential buildings?
Sound insulation in residential buildings provides enhanced privacy, reduces noise pollution, improves sleep quality, and increases overall comfort. It helps create a peaceful living environment by minimizing disturbances from external and internal noise sources. Additionally, effective sound insulation can raise a property's value and energy efficiency.
What is the difference between soundproofing and sound absorption?
Soundproofing is the process of preventing sound from entering or leaving a space by blocking or isolating sound waves. Sound absorption involves using materials to reduce echo and reverberation within a space by soaking up sound waves.
How does sound insulation affect energy efficiency in buildings?
Sound insulation enhances energy efficiency by providing thermal insulation benefits, reducing the need for heating or cooling. By sealing gaps and adding mass to walls, floors, and ceilings, it minimizes air leakage and maintains consistent indoor temperatures, which decreases energy consumption and utility costs.
